METHODS FOR IDENTIFICATION OF THE ELEMENTS OF THE PROSTATE NEUROVASCULAR BUNDLE (A REVIEW OF LITERATURE)

Abstract

<p><em>With regard to a considerable number of erective dysfunction after radical prostatectomy and a rise in the number of patients concerned with postoperative potency preservation, the identification of neurovascular bundles (NVB) remains an urgent problem. Different NVB imaging procedures exist today; however, there is now no method that is optimal and able to prevent cavernous nerve injury with high probability and reduce the number of complications. The advantages and disadvantages of these procedures should be determined by the long-term functional results of their use, which were assessed in randomized studies.</em></p
